④   
Disconnect the hall sensor and stator connection 
before removing the stator in the subsequent step.

⑤  
    
Remove the six screws securing the rotor. 
      
⑥  
    
Check the position of the snap ring, being cure it 
faces the rotor and stator. 
      
⑦  
    
To keep from dropping the stator, loosen the six 
bolts almost all the way; then hold the stator in one 
hand while removing the bolts with the other. 
      
⑧  
    
Be careful during removal and replacement to 
avoid cutting, nicking, or pinching any of the wires. 
This could cause a short or electrical noise in the 
machine. 
      
③    
Remove the screws that secure the water guide.
